Farm fence repair services involve assessing and restoring existing fencing structures to ensure they function effectively and maintain property boundaries. These services typically include replacing damaged or rotted posts, fixing broken or sagging wire, and restoring fencing panels to their proper alignment. Skilled contractors may also reinforce fencing to withstand weather conditions and prevent future damage, helping property owners maintain secure and well-defined boundaries.
Fences often face issues such as leaning posts, broken wire strands, rust, or sections that have been knocked down by animals or weather events. Repair services address these problems by restoring the structural integrity of the fence, preventing animals from escaping, and keeping unwanted visitors out. Proper fencing also helps in managing livestock, protecting crops, and maintaining privacy on residential or commercial properties.

The overview below groups typical Farm Fence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in San Fernando, CA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Material Costs - The cost of fencing materials can range from $1 to $5 per linear foot, depending on the type of wood, wire, or metal used. For example, a 100-foot section might cost between $100 and $500 in materials alone.
Labor Expenses - Labor for fence repair typically ranges from $50 to $100 per hour, with total costs varying based on the extent of damage. Repairs on a standard fence may take a few hours, resulting in total labor charges between $150 and $400.
Extent of Damage - Minor repairs, such as replacing a few broken posts or sections, may cost between $200 and $500. More extensive damage, including complete fence replacement, can range from $1,000 to $3,000 or more.
Additional Costs - Factors like permits, land clearing, or additional hardware can add to the overall expense, often totaling between $50 and $300. Local pros can provide detailed estimates based on specific repair needs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
